Can HPS arm and FPGA fabric shared DDR?

Hi,

I have a question about DDR usage:

1. Can HPS arm and FPGA fabric share DDR.

2. if DDR has 4 channels, can HPS use 2 channels to access DDR and FPGA fabric access through the other 2 channels? but they are independent access?

    Hi lidongyang


    Yes you are able to share DDR between the FPGA Fabric and HPS arm.

    HPS Arm is able to access the DDR through the DDR Controller or HPS EMIF depending on device through the L2 Cache. The FPGA Fabirc is able to access the DDR through the FPGA2HPS bridge through the L3 cache.
